The Bulldogs head out on their annual Spring Break trip, which will have Butler playing 12 games over the next 10 days.
Butler will start with five games in Memphis, Tenn., at an event hosted by the University of Memphis. The first game is a Friday morning first pitch against Western Carolina. The Bulldogs will also play Indiana State, host Memphis, Belmont and Youngstown State over the weekend.
From Memphis, the Bulldogs will head to Madeira Beach, Fla., returning to a location that has been good to the team so far in 2020. Butler went 4-2 at the venue in games played there Feb. 14-16. Butler will play seven games in Madeira Beach, beginning Wednesday.
Butler's strong start has resulted in a 12-4 mark so far during the 2020 campaign.
The pitching staff has posted a 1.91 team ERA so far this season. The duo of
Alyssa Graves and
Karli Ricketts has combined for 116 strikeouts in 83.2 innings of work.
Mackenzie Griman and
Madison Seigworth also have ERAs under 2.00. The staff's 1.91 ERA is 21
st nationally.
Ricketts leads the team, and is among the top spots in the BIG EAST, with six home runs. Sophomore
Lauren Fey and her .423 batting average pace the team.
The Bulldogs have been stellar with their glovework as the team's .982 fielding percentage is seventh nationally.
Following the Spring Break trip, the Bulldogs will open the home portion of their schedule Tuesday, March 17 when Green Bay visits Indianapolis. BIG EAST play begins March 20-22 when the Bulldogs travel to DePaul.
